是否有某种应用程序可用于编写文档以供离线使用,然后稍后将文本复制/粘贴到维基百科?如果没有,是否有某种 wiki 到 pdf 或 doc 到 wiki 的转换器?
答案1
就像是这?显然可以离线工作。引用...
在没有 Wiki 的情况下使用 Wiki 标记
即使将 Wiki 作为主要文档存储库,也并非所有文档都会出现在 Wiki 中。某些文档需要作为源树的一部分进行管理 - 例如 Readme、编译说明等。这些信息通常为纯文本或某种文本处理器格式,大多与 Microsoft Word 兼容。两者都存在一些问题。Word 文档很大、很臃肿、难以进行版本控制,并且在 shell 环境中无法读取(尝试 cat 或 tail Word 文档 :-D )。纯文本格式缺乏视觉结构,没有标题、粗体/斜体、字体大小等,阅读起来更困难。
我正在进行的一些项目尝试使用 HTML 作为文档格式 - 但使用“程序员编辑器”进行编辑太困难了......并且从可读性和版本管理的角度来看,MS-Word 生成的 HTML 并不比二进制格式好多少。
一种效果非常好的格式是带有 Wiki 标记结构的纯文本。有各种各样的标记可供选择,我最喜欢的是纺织品标记(许多 Wiki 系统都实现了该标记,包括合流)。 Textile 非常容易记住,阅读起来自然,并且为文档提供了足够的结构,而不会妨碍阅读。 使用 Textile 作为“源标记”允许我们将文档内容直接复制并粘贴到 Wiki 中(如果需要)。 还可以使用适用于所有感兴趣的语言的库(就我而言是 C#、Java、Python、Ruby,希望也能找到适用于 Objective-C 的库)将 Textile 轻松转换为完整的 HTML。
使用 Textile 的最佳功能是,一些编辑器(即 Mac 上的 TextMate)本身支持 Textile,即使没有预处理步骤也能正确显示标题和字体属性。并且使用预览功能甚至可以立即生成 HTML。使用插件也可以完成类似的操作編輯以及记事本++有了这个语法文件。